body    {
    font-family: Arial, Verdana, Geneva, Helvetica, sans-serif;
    font-size: 12px;
    margin-top: 20px;
    margin-left: 10px;
    padding: 0px;
    background-color: #FFFFFF;
    background-repeat: repeat-x;
    background-image: url('../images/bg2.png');
    overflow: -moz-scrollbars-vertical;
    scrollbar-face-color: #000000;
}
img      {border: none;}
td {font-size: 13px;}
h1 {font-size: 26px; color:#000000; margin: 0; padding: 0px; font-family: sans-serif; font-weight: bold; text-align: center;}
h2 {font-size: 22px; color:#E00606; margin: 0; padding: 0px; font-family: sans-serif; font-weight: bold; text-align: center;}
h3 {font-size: 20px; color:#000000; margin: 0; padding: 0px; font-family: sans-serif;}
h4 {font-size: 14px; color:#000000; margin: 0; padding: 0px; text-align: center;}

.pad10 {padding: 10px 10px 10px 10px;}

.white {font-size: 13px; color:#FFFFFF; margin: 0; padding: 0px; text-align: center;}
.red   {font-size: 13px; color:#E00606; margin: 0; padding: 0px; text-align: center; font-weight: bold;}
.redl  {font-size: 13px; color:#E00606; margin: 0; padding: 0px; text-align: left; font-weight: bold;}
.grey  {font-size: 13px; color:#808080; margin: 0; padding: 0px; text-align: center; font-weight: bold;}

.art    {text-align: right;  vertical-align: top;}
.act    {text-align: center; vertical-align: top;}
.alt    {text-align: left;   vertical-align: top;}
.acm    {text-align: center; vertical-align: middle;}
.arm    {text-align: right;  vertical-align: middle;}
.arb    {text-align: right;  vertical-align: bottom;}
.alb    {text-align: left;  vertical-align: bottom;}
.acb    {text-align: center; vertical-align: bottom;}

.act100pc    {text-align: center; vertical-align: top; height: 100%;}

.h50p   {height: 50%;}
.h90pc  {height: 90%}
.h100pc {height: 100%}
.h80px  {height: 80px;}
.h60px  {height: 60px;}
.h100px {height: 100px;}
.h110px {height: 110px;}
.h140px {height: 140px;}
.h180px {height: 180px;}
.h160px {height: 160px;}
.h190px {height: 190px;}
.h300px {height: 300px;}

a.footer         {color: black; font-weight: bold; font-size: 14px; text-align: center; text-decoration: none;}
a.footer:visited {color: black;}
a.footer:hover   {color: white;}

a.footertemp         {color: gray; font-weight: bold; font-size: 16px; text-align: center;}
a.footertemp:visited {color: gray;}
a.footertemp:hover   {color: #789EB5;}

a.leftm         {color: #3A73A8; font-weight: bold; font-size: 13px; text-align: center;}
a.leftm:visited {color: #3A73A8;}
a.leftm:hover   {color: #C00000; font-size: 14px;}

.menu {
    text-align: center;
    vertical-align: middle;
    height: 26px;
    width: 25%;
    background-position: center;
    background-repeat: no-repeat;
    background-image: url('../images/butt1.png');
    padding: 20px;
}
.address {
    text-align: center;
    vertical-align: middle;
    padding: 6px;
}
.border {
	border-style: solid;
	border-bottom: 2px solid #C0C0C0;
	border-top: 2px solid #C0C0C0;
	border-right: 2px solid #C0C0C0;
	border-left: 2px solid #C0C0C0;
}
img.ridge {
	border-style: ridge;
}
img.inset {
	border-style: inset;
}
img.outset {
	border-style: outset;
	border-bottom: 2px solid #028E02;
	border-top: 2px solid #028E02;
	border-left: 2px solid #028E02;
	border-right: 2px solid #028E02;
}
div#sweep{
    height: 100%;
    background-repeat: no-repeat;
    background-image: url('../images/sweep4.png');
    background-position: 40px 30px;
    z-index: 0;

}

.main    {
    font-family: Verdana, Geneva, Helvetica, sans-serif;
    font-size: 13px;
    height: 100%;
    margin-top: 14px;
    padding: 0px;
/*
    background-repeat: no-repeat;
    background-image: url('../images/sweep4.png');
    background-position: 0% 0px;
*/
}
.list  {
    font-family: Verdana, Geneva, Helvetica, sans-serif;
    font-size: 12px;
    height: 100%;
    margin-top: 14px;
    padding: 10px;
    font-weight: bold;
}

.textc  {
    font-family: Verdana, Geneva, Helvetica, sans-serif;
    font-size: 12px;
    font-weight: bold;
    text-align: center;
    vertical-align: top;
}

.text  {
    font-family: Verdana, Geneva, Helvetica, sans-serif;
    font-size: 12px;
    font-weight: bold;
    vertical-align: top;
}
.textm {
    font-family: Verdana, Geneva, Helvetica, sans-serif;
    font-size: 12px;
    font-weight: bold;
    vertical-align: middle;
}

li  {
    font-family: Verdana, Geneva, Helvetica, sans-serif;
    font-size: 12px;
    font-weight: bold;
}
.redlist  {
    font-family: Verdana, Geneva, Helvetica, sans-serif;
    font-size: 12px;
    font-weight: bold;
    text-indent: 10px;
    height: 20px;
}

#redbullet ul  {list-style-image: url('../images/bullet.gif');}


.bord {
    border-width: 1px;
    border-style: inset;
    border-color: grey;
    height: 100%;
}


#imgbord a img            {
                 border-width: 2px;
                 border-style: inset;
                 border-color: #F2F6FE;
}
#imgbord a:visited img    {
                 border-width: 2px;
                 border-style: inset;
                 border-color: #F2F6FE;
}
#imgbord a:hover img      {
                 border-width: 2px;
                 border-style: inset;
                 border-color: #F2F6FE;
}
.attention {
    font-size: 22px;
    color:#E00606;
    font-weight: bold;
    text-align: center;
    vertical-align: middle;
}

.redheadc {
    font-size: 22px;
    color:#E00606;
    font-weight: bold;
    text-align: center;
}
.redheadl {
    font-size: 22px;
    color:#E00606;
    font-weight: bold;
    text-align: left;
}
.arrowr, .arrowl {
    background-repeat: no-repeat;
    background-image: url('../images/rarrow.gif');
    background-position: 0px 50%;
}
.table {
    margin-top: 20px;
    padding: 0px;
}

